¿Cómo predicen los algoritmos las preferencias de los usuarios?

En el entorno digital actual, es común ver plataformas que parecen "adivinar" los gustos de los usuarios. Videos sugeridos, productos recomendados, música similar y contenido personalizado aparecen constantemente en aplicaciones y sitios web. Esta capacidad de predecir preferencias no se basa en la intuición, sino en sistemas matemáticos avanzados conocidos como algoritmos de recomendación.

Estos algoritmos analizan grandes cantidades de datos sobre el comportamiento de los usuarios e identifican patrones que ayudan a predecir sus intereses futuros. Con base en esta información, las plataformas pueden ofrecer contenido y sugerencias cada vez más acordes con el perfil de cada persona.

¿Qué son los algoritmos de recomendación?

Los algoritmos de recomendación son sistemas diseñados para sugerir contenido o productos basándose en datos.

Analizan la información recopilada durante el uso de la aplicación, como el historial de visualización, las búsquedas realizadas, el tiempo dedicado a contenido específico y las interacciones con otros usuarios.

Basándose en esta información, el sistema intenta identificar patrones de preferencias.

Recopilación de datos de comportamiento

El primer paso para predecir las preferencias es recopilar datos.

Cada interacción dentro de una aplicación genera información útil para el algoritmo. Los "me gusta", las veces que se comparte, los comentarios, el tiempo que se pasa en una página e incluso las pausas en los vídeos ayudan a comprender el comportamiento del usuario.

Estos datos constituyen la base de los análisis realizados por los sistemas.

Análisis de los patrones de uso

Tras recopilar los datos, los algoritmos buscan patrones.

Por ejemplo, si un usuario ve con frecuencia vídeos sobre un tema en particular o escucha música de un estilo específico, el sistema identifica esta tendencia.

Anuncios

Basándose en estos patrones, el algoritmo comienza a predecir qué contenido podría resultar más interesante para ese usuario.

Comparación con perfiles similares

Otro método común consiste en comparar usuarios con comportamientos similares.

Si a varias personas con hábitos similares les gusta cierto contenido, hay muchas probabilidades de que otros usuarios con perfiles similares también estén interesados.

Este tipo de análisis se conoce como filtrado colaborativo.

Filtrado basado en contenido

Además de comparar a los usuarios, los algoritmos también analizan las características del contenido.

Identifican elementos como temas, categorías, palabras clave y formatos. Si el usuario muestra interés en ciertos tipos de contenido, el sistema busca elementos similares.

Esta técnica ayuda a ampliar las recomendaciones sin depender exclusivamente de otros usuarios.

Aprendizaje continuo del sistema

Los algoritmos aprenden constantemente a partir de nuevos datos.

Cada nueva interacción actualiza el modelo utilizado por el sistema. Con el tiempo, las predicciones se vuelven más precisas.

Este proceso se conoce como aprendizaje automático.

Análisis del tiempo de interacción

El tiempo que un usuario dedica a consumir contenido específico también es un indicador importante.

Si una persona dedica mucho tiempo a ver un vídeo o leer un artículo, el sistema lo interpreta como una señal de interés.

El contenido con tiempos de interacción más prolongados tiende a influir en las recomendaciones futuras.

Importancia de las acciones explícitas

Algunas acciones proporcionan señales claras a los algoritmos.

Los "me gusta", las valoraciones positivas, los guardados y las veces que se comparte un contenido indican directamente que al usuario le ha gustado dicho contenido.

Estas señales ayudan al sistema a ajustar sus sugerencias.

Uso de datos contextuales

Los algoritmos también tienen en cuenta el contexto.

Información como el tiempo de uso, la ubicación aproximada o el tipo de dispositivo pueden influir en las recomendaciones.

Por ejemplo, el contenido que se consume por la noche puede ser diferente del que se consulta durante la jornada laboral.

Identificación de tendencias globales

Además de las preferencias individuales, los algoritmos analizan las tendencias generales.

El contenido que se está popularizando entre muchos usuarios puede recomendarse con mayor frecuencia.

Esto ayuda a destacar temas nuevos y de actualidad.

Ajuste constante de las recomendaciones

Los sistemas ajustan sus sugerencias en función de la respuesta del usuario.

Si una recomendación no genera interacción, el algoritmo reduce la probabilidad de sugerir contenido similar.

Este proceso ayuda a perfeccionar las previsiones con el tiempo.

Combinación de diferentes métodos

En la práctica, las plataformas utilizan varios métodos simultáneamente.

El filtrado colaborativo, el análisis de contenido y el aprendizaje automático se combinan para generar recomendaciones más precisas.

Este enfoque híbrido aumenta la eficiencia de los algoritmos.

Personalización a gran escala

Uno de los mayores retos para las plataformas digitales es ofrecer experiencias personalizadas a millones de usuarios.

Los algoritmos son capaces de analizar enormes volúmenes de datos y generar recomendaciones específicas para cada persona.

Esta personalización es uno de los pilares fundamentales de la economía digital.

Influencia de las interacciones recientes

La actividad reciente suele tener un peso significativo en las recomendaciones.

Si un usuario comienza a consumir contenido sobre un tema nuevo, el algoritmo ajusta rápidamente sus sugerencias.

Esto permite que el sistema realice un seguimiento de los cambios en los intereses.

Reducir la sobrecarga de información

En internet hay una enorme cantidad de contenido disponible.

Los algoritmos ayudan a filtrar esta información, presentando solo lo que probablemente sea de mayor interés.

Este filtro facilita la navegación y mejora la experiencia del usuario.

Identificar intereses ocultos

Los algoritmos también pueden identificar relaciones indirectas entre el contenido.

Por ejemplo, las personas interesadas en un tema en particular también pueden estar interesadas en temas relacionados.

Estas conexiones ayudan a ampliar el universo de recomendaciones.

Mejora constante de los modelos

Los modelos utilizados por los algoritmos se actualizan con frecuencia.

Los ingenieros y los científicos de datos ajustan los sistemas para hacerlos más eficientes y reducir los errores.

Esta mejora continua aumenta la calidad de las recomendaciones.

Influencia de la inteligencia artificial

La inteligencia artificial desempeña un papel fundamental en este proceso.

Los modelos avanzados son capaces de identificar patrones extremadamente complejos en grandes volúmenes de datos.

Esto permite realizar predicciones cada vez más precisas sobre las preferencias de los usuarios.

Desafíos y limitaciones de los algoritmos

A pesar de su eficiencia, los algoritmos no son perfectos.

Pueden reforzar las preferencias existentes y limitar la exposición a contenido nuevo.

Este fenómeno se conoce como "burbuja de recomendaciones".

Equilibrio entre personalización y diversidad.

Para evitar limitaciones en las recomendaciones, algunas plataformas intentan incluir contenido variado.

Combinar sugerencias predecibles con nuevas funciones ayuda a mejorar la experiencia del usuario.

Este equilibrio hace que las recomendaciones sean más interesantes.

Cómo los algoritmos parecen "adivinar" los gustos

La sensación de que las aplicaciones saben exactamente lo que los usuarios quieren ver no es magia, sino el resultado de un análisis de datos complejo. Al observar patrones de comportamiento, comparar perfiles similares y aprender continuamente de cada interacción, los algoritmos pueden predecir intereses con gran precisión. Esta combinación de recopilación de datos, aprendizaje automático y personalización a gran escala transforma la experiencia digital, permitiendo que cada usuario reciba contenido adaptado a su perfil en plataformas cada vez más inteligentes.

ARTÍCULOS RELACIONADOS

relacionado